Save and Activate the Scenario
After configuring Beamer, Cloze, and any additional nodes, don’t forget to save the scenario and click "Deploy." Activating the scenario ensures it will run automatically whenever the trigger node receives input or a condition is met. By default, all newly created scenarios are deactivated.
Test the Scenario
Run the scenario by clicking “Run once” and triggering an event to check if the Beamer and Cloze integration works as expected. Depending on your setup, data should flow between Beamer and Cloze (or vice versa). Easily troubleshoot the scenario by reviewing the execution history to identify and fix any issues.

Are there any limitations to the Beamer and Cloze integration on Latenode?
While the integration is powerful, there are certain limitations to be aware of:
- Historical Beamer data prior to integration setup isn't automatically synced.
- Complex Beamer data transformations may require JavaScript coding.
- Rate limits imposed by Beamer and Cloze APIs may affect performance.
